Amachine fills containers with a particular product. the standard deviation of filling weights is known from past data to be .6 ounce. if only 2% of the containers hold less than 18 ounces, what is the mean filling weight for the machine? that is, what must m equal? assume the filling weights have a normal distribution. anderson, david r.. essentials of statistics for business and economics (p. 299). south-western college pub. kindle edition.
